Notice Regarding the Stillbirth of Bottlenose Dolphin "Ten"'s Baby
.png)
Kyoto Aquarium regrets to inform you that while bottlenose dolphin "Ten" gave birth on Monday, June 29, 2026, the baby has unfortunately passed away.
In early September 2025, during a regular blood test conducted for health monitoring, signs of pregnancy were observed in Ten, and a fetus was confirmed by subsequent ultrasound examination.
On Monday, June 29th, a drop in body temperature, a sign of impending labor, was observed, and the birth was confirmed at 11:30 PM that day. However, the baby did not swim, and it was immediately confirmed to be a stillbirth.
Ten's health is stable and there are no problems, but we will prioritize his recovery.
Please note that the dolphin stadium, which had been closed since Tuesday, June 30th for preparations for the birth of a dolphin, will reopen on Thursday, July 2nd. The dolphin program is scheduled to resume as soon as the environment is ready.
We would like to express our sincere gratitude to everyone who supported Ten's first birth. Kyoto Aquarium will continue to cherish and properly care for animals.
[The sequence of events from pregnancy to the confirmation of death after birth]
In September 2025, blood tests and ultrasound examinations revealed that the bottlenose dolphin "Ten" was pregnant.
June 13, 2026: Dolphin program suspended due to preparations for childbirth.
June 29, 2026, 8:10 AM: Observation began after a drop in body temperature, a sign of impending labor.
June 29, 2026, 8:50 PM: Bleeding was observed from the genital opening.
June 29, 2026, 10:10 PM: Water rupture confirmed.
June 29, 2026, 10:27 PM: Confirmed that the fetus's tail fin has emerged.
June 29, 2026, 11:30 PM: Birth and death of the offspring confirmed.
[About baby animals]
Sex: Male (Length 105cm, Weight 15kg)
Mother: Ten, estimated 17 years old (transported to Kyoto Aquarium on December 22, 2011) Father: Seed, estimated 19 years old (transported to Kyoto Aquarium on December 22, 2011)
